Designed in the late 60s, built throughout the 70s in New York, you will need SAE hex keys to fit McIntosh products......3/32nds but I will need to check my set to be sure.

Do not use metric keys
Use US type
 
Hogging the screw socket holes and or splitting them and making it all but impossible to remove can happen with the wrong size or style of wrench, so beware and be careful.
